History
Action for Pulmonary Fibrosis (APF) was established in 2013 by a group of individuals affected by pulmonary fibrosis and clinicians. The organization is headquartered in the United Kingdom and operates as a registered charity. Since its inception, APF has grown into a thriving community dedicated to transforming the lives of those affected by pulmonary fibrosis.
Mission and Goals
Action for Pulmonary Fibrosis exists to support individuals affected by pulmonary fibrosis, including patients, their families, and caregivers. The organization aims to improve the quality of life for these individuals by providing expert support, information, and education. APF also seeks to raise awareness of pulmonary fibrosis and drive change to improve health and care services. Additionally, the organization is committed to supporting research efforts to discover new and effective treatments for this devastating disease.
Target Group
APF specifically supports individuals diagnosed with pulmonary fibrosis, a condition characterized by lung scarring. The organization also extends its support to the families and caregivers of those living with the condition.
Main Activities
Action for Pulmonary Fibrosis engages in several primary activities, including:
- Advocacy: Campaigning for better awareness and understanding of pulmonary fibrosis among policymakers and the general public.
- Education: Providing educational resources and information to patients, families, and healthcare professionals.
- Direct Support Programs: Offering support services such as information hotlines, support groups, and telephone befriending.
Types of Support Offered
APF provides concrete assistance to patients and their families through various support mechanisms, including:
- Information Hotlines: Offering guidance and information on living with pulmonary fibrosis.
- Consultations: Providing access to expert advice and support from healthcare professionals.
- Educational Materials: Distributing resources to help patients and families understand and manage the condition.
- Workshops: Organizing events and webinars to educate and connect the pulmonary fibrosis community.
Achievements
Since its establishment, Action for Pulmonary Fibrosis has made significant strides in raising awareness and supporting research into pulmonary fibrosis. The organization has successfully funded research fellowships and contributed to the development of new treatment options. APF's efforts have also led to the creation of a comprehensive support network for individuals affected by the disease across the UK.
